idea常用设置
idea常用设置
1、 取消默认直接打开项目
2、 显示行号和方法线
3、 设置tab多行显示
4、 设置自动根据屏幕代码换行
5、 设置Ctrl+滚轮 缩放字体和图片
6、 文件头注释
/**
* ******************************
* @DESCRIPTION ${DESCRIPTION}
*
* @Author xin
* @Create ${DATE} ${TIME}
* ******************************
*/
7、 方法注释
Template text里写:
仔细看模板开头不是/
*
$params$
* @return $return$
* @creatDate $DATE$ $TIME$
*/
注意变量被 $$ 包围
右侧的Edit variables还可以点击哦。
考虑到多参数 params 修改为:
groovyScript("def result=''; def params=\"${_1}\".replaceAll('[\\\\[|\\\\]|\\\\s]', '').split(',').toList(); for(i = 1; i < params.size() +1; i++) {result+='* @param ' + params[i - 1] + ((i < params.size()) ? '\\n ' : '')}; return result", methodParameters())
然后点击,然后选择Everywhere
注意了,正确的使用方式:
方法上面一行,输入/** 回车。
8、代码提示忽略大小写
搜索Code Completion ->Match case -> 勾选去掉.
9、设置编码格式
10、常用插件
-
lombok
代码注解插件 添加注解 @Data,即可省去手写getter, setter, toString的麻烦
-
Translation
翻译插件
-
Grep Console
日志工具 控制台console输出日志时区分颜色
-
Rainbow Brackets
括号相同颜色 彩色括号
-
MyBatis Log Plugin
将Mybatis执行的sql脚本显示出来,无需处理,可以直接复制出来执行的 (现在收费了)
-
alibaba-java-coding-guidelines
阿里巴巴编码规约插件
11、快捷键生成serialVersionUID
12、设置自动编译
13、删除无用的import包的引用
1.手动快捷键
Ctrl + Alt + O
2.配置自动清理
Ctrl + Alt + S 打开设置
然后,进行如下操作:
IDEA会自动清理无引用的包。
“群体盲从意识会淹没个体的理性,个体一旦将自己归于该群体,其原本独立的理性就会被群体的无知疯狂所淹没.”